Technical field
The present invention relates to a kind of substratum that is used for human embryo kidney (HEK) 293 cell cultures, specifically, relate to a kind of serum free medium of the HEK293 of being used for cell cultures.
Background technology
Human embryo kidney (HEK) 293 cells are at first set up in 1977 by Graham etc., are the desirable hosts who produces recombinant adenovirus.
Traditional substratum of HEK293 cell is that blood serum medium is arranged.But, there is the use of blood serum medium to be restricted along with people improve constantly the understanding that animal serum may pollute production process even the finished product.Serum free medium, with its have passivity pollute, batch between otherness advantages such as separation and purification little and that help expression product more and more be subjected to people's attention.
The existing at present serum free medium that is fit to the HEK293 cell cultures has: 293-SFMII (Invitrogen), Ex-Cell 525 (JRH), IS293-SF (Irvine Scientific), Pro293s-CDM (Cambrex), CD293 Medium, Freestyle
TM293 and Expression Medium (Gibco) etc., but the price comparison costliness of these serum free mediums.Therefore this area presses for the serum free medium of a kind of low cost of research and development and suitable HEK293 cell cultures.
Summary of the invention
The object of the invention is, a kind of low cost is provided and has been applicable to the serum free medium of human embryo kidney (HEK) 293 cell cultures.
Design of the present invention is such:
In the serum free medium owing to lack serum, the essential blood serum substituting factor of adding, current, the recruitment factor kind of alternative serum has a lot, generally includes somatomedin, hormone, lipid, conjugated protein and trace element etc.In order to develop the serum free medium that is fit to the HEK293 cell, the present invention has added following serum substitute:
(1) Transferrins,iron complexes: a kind of glycoprotein in conjunction with iron, with the single-minded receptor acting of cell surface, transmit iron ion.
(2) Regular Insulin: beta Cell of islet excretory polypeptide hormone, promote the cell growth, regulate the metabolism of glucose and lipid.
(3) Primatone: a kind of peptone, can play stable and the active function of adjusting above-mentioned substance in anteserum-less substrate by combining with VITAMIN, lipid, metal ion, hormone and somatomedin.In the stir culture system, the mechanicalness protection effect that viscosity by influencing substratum and oncotic pressure are brought into play pair cell.
(4) lipid mixture: phosphatide is the integral part of cell, adds lipid mixture and can promote the synthetic of phosphatide, accelerates the synthetic of cytolemma, increases the slipperiness of cytolemma.
Because lack the effect of serum, corresponding variation can take place the metabolism situation of cell when serum-free culture, nutritional needs is corresponding to change, and for this reason, changes the content of composition on the basis of the nutritive ingredient of basic medium that must be when having serum to cultivate.Amino acid is the precursor of protein synthesis, and its utilization is also grown for cell and product production provides energy.Amino acid can also be alleviated the influence of generation, carbonic acid gas and the osmotic pressure of ammonia.The production of adenovirus has bigger demand to amino acid, and therefore, HEK293 cell non-serum culture medium of the present invention contains than the more amino acid of general basic medium.

Cultivate the HEK293 cell that has adapted to the serum-free suspension culture in the square vase of 125ml, inoculum density is 3 * 10
5Cells/ml, liquid amount are 20ml, and the square vase that will connect seed cell again places shaking table, and (model: TZ-03, (shaking table is placed on 36.5 ℃, 5%CO SHENERGYBIOCOLOR) to go up cultivation
2In the incubator), rotating speed is 120r/min, cultivates 5 days, maximum cell density reaches 3.8 * 10
6Cells/ml.Result such as Fig. 1.The serum free medium that present embodiment uses is made by embodiment 1.
Comparative Examples 1
Cultivate adherent HEK293 cell in the square vase of 125ml, inoculum density is 3 * 10
5Cells/ml, square vase are placed on 36.5 ℃, 5%CO
2In the incubator, different is: the substratum of adding is DMEM+10% foetal calf serum (FBS), and liquid amount is 10ml, and static cultivation was cultivated 5 days, and maximum cell density is 2.6 * 10
6Cells/ml.Result such as Fig. 1, serum free medium of the present invention are suitable for HEK293 cell high-density growth.
